diff options
author | ReinUsesLisp <reinuseslisp@airmail.cc> | 2019-02-08 22:32:58 +0100 |
---|---|---|
committer | ReinUsesLisp <reinuseslisp@airmail.cc> | 2019-02-08 22:32:58 +0100 |
commit | e36e7ae74e7a2a1313230872bac148f0b6a1df37 (patch) | |
tree | d4d7a95711306a82a0ecd65f65d5b38f3c167ff5 /src/video_core | |
parent | Merge pull request #2083 from ReinUsesLisp/shader-ir-cbuf-tracking (diff) | |
download | y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.tar y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.tar.gz y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.tar.bz2 y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.tar.lz y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.tar.xz y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.tar.zst yuzu-e36e7ae74e7a2a1313230872bac148f0b6a1df37.zip |
Diffstat (limited to 'src/video_core')
-rw-r--r-- | src/video_core/renderer_opengl/gl_rasterizer_cache.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/video_core/renderer_opengl/gl_rasterizer_cache.cpp b/src/video_core/renderer_opengl/gl_rasterizer_cache.cpp index a79eee03e..b77768c79 100644 --- a/src/video_core/renderer_opengl/gl_rasterizer_cache.cpp +++ b/src/video_core/renderer_opengl/gl_rasterizer_cache.cpp @@ -853,8 +853,8 @@ void CachedSurface::EnsureTextureView() { constexpr GLuint min_level = 0; glGenTextures(1, &texture_view.handle); - glTextureView(texture_view.handle, target, texture.handle, gl_internal_format, 0, - params.max_mip_level, 0, 1); + glTextureView(texture_view.handle, target, texture.handle, gl_internal_format, min_level, + params.max_mip_level, min_layer, num_layers); ApplyTextureDefaults(texture_view.handle, params.max_mip_level); glTextureParameteriv(texture_view.handle, GL_TEXTURE_SWIZZLE_RGBA, reinterpret_cast<const GLint*>(swizzle.data())); |